news 2026/4/18 10:14:57

在Linux系统上轻松搭建macOS虚拟机的终极指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
在Linux系统上轻松搭建macOS虚拟机的终极指南

在Linux系统上轻松搭建macOS虚拟机的终极指南

【免费下载链接】OneClick-macOS-Simple-KVMTools to set up a easy, quick macOS VM in QEMU, accelerated by KVM. Works on Linux AND Windows.项目地址: https://gitcode.com/gh_mirrors/on/OneClick-macOS-Simple-KVM

想要在Linux环境中体验macOS的魅力吗?现在只需简单几步,你就能在自己的电脑上运行完整的苹果操作系统!这款免费工具让macOS虚拟机搭建变得前所未有的简单。

为什么选择这款虚拟机方案?

你是否曾因无法使用Xcode开发iOS应用而苦恼?或者想在非苹果硬件上运行Final Cut Pro进行视频剪辑?这款基于QEMU和KVM加速的解决方案完美解决了这些问题!

核心优势

  • 完全免费开源,无需购买苹果硬件
  • 支持从High Sierra到Ventura的多个macOS版本
  • 利用KVM硬件加速,性能接近原生体验
  • 一键式安装配置,告别复杂的技术操作

快速上手:三步完成部署

第一步:获取项目代码

git clone https://gitcode.com/gh_mirrors/on/OneClick-macOS-Simple-KVM cd OneClick-macOS-Simple-KVM

第二步:运行自动化脚本

执行./setup.sh脚本,系统会自动处理所有复杂配置。项目提供了多个版本的支持脚本,包括bigsur-offline.shmonterey-offline.sh等,满足不同macOS版本需求。

第三步:个性化配置

根据提示调整内存分配和CPU核心数,建议分配尽可能多的资源以获得最佳性能体验。

实用功能详解

离线安装支持

项目特别提供了offline-iso-creators/目录,包含多个离线安装脚本。这对于网络环境不稳定的用户来说是个福音,你可以提前准备好安装镜像,随时进行安装。

多系统兼容性

除了标准的setup.sh,项目还针对不同Linux发行版提供了专用脚本:

  • setupArch.sh- Arch Linux用户
  • setupFedora.sh- Fedora用户
  • setupSUSE.sh- openSUSE用户

虚拟化增强

virtio.sh脚本优化了虚拟设备的性能,而firmware/目录中的OVMF固件文件确保了系统的稳定启动。

使用场景与技巧

🎯 开发者的完美搭档

  • iOS应用开发:运行最新版Xcode
  • 跨平台测试:在不同macOS版本间切换测试
  • 学习环境:在不购买苹果设备的情况下学习macOS开发

💡 性能优化建议

  • 启用桥接网络以获得更好的网络性能
  • 定期使用git pull --rebase更新到最新版本
  • 为虚拟机分配足够的内存(建议8GB以上)

🔧 维护与更新

项目结构清晰,主要配置文件集中在根目录,工具脚本分类存放。tools/目录包含额外的转换工具,OpenCore.qcow2提供了现代化的引导解决方案。

常见问题解答

Q: 需要什么硬件要求?A: 支持Intel VT-x或AMD-V的CPU,建议16GB以上内存。

Q: 支持哪些macOS版本?A: 从High Sierra到最新的Ventura,覆盖了苹果近年发布的所有主要版本。

Q: 是否支持Windows系统?A: 是的!该项目同样支持在Windows系统上运行。

这款工具真正做到了"开箱即用",让复杂的macOS虚拟化变得简单易懂。无论你是开发者、设计师,还是只是想体验macOS的普通用户,都能从中受益。现在就动手试试吧,开启你的macOS虚拟化之旅!

【免费下载链接】OneClick-macOS-Simple-KVMTools to set up a easy, quick macOS VM in QEMU, accelerated by KVM. Works on Linux AND Windows.项目地址: https://gitcode.com/gh_mirrors/on/OneClick-macOS-Simple-KVM

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/18 7:42:10

避免踩坑:CAM++云端部署,比本地省时省力又省钱

避免踩坑:CAM云端部署,比本地省时省力又省钱 你是不是也遇到过这样的情况?作为一名工程师,第一次接触说话人识别任务,满心期待地想用开源模型快速搞定项目需求。结果呢?光是配置环境就花了整整两天——Pyt…

作者头像 李华
网站建设 2026/4/18 5:44:32

RS485通讯电源去耦设计:稳定性提升操作指南

RS485通信稳定性从“电源去耦”抓起:实战派设计指南在工业现场,你有没有遇到过这样的场景?一条跑得好好的RS485总线,突然因为旁边一台变频器启动就开始丢包;或者系统冷机上电正常,高温运行几小时后通讯频繁…

作者头像 李华
网站建设 2026/3/22 12:28:58

PDF补丁丁字体嵌入全攻略:彻底告别跨设备显示乱码

PDF补丁丁字体嵌入全攻略:彻底告别跨设备显示乱码 【免费下载链接】PDFPatcher PDF补丁丁——PDF工具箱,可以编辑书签、剪裁旋转页面、解除限制、提取或合并文档,探查文档结构,提取图片、转成图片等等 项目地址: https://gitcod…

作者头像 李华
网站建设 2026/4/17 14:50:36

Qwen3-VL物流分拣系统:包裹信息识别部署案例

Qwen3-VL物流分拣系统:包裹信息识别部署案例 1. 引言:智能物流中的视觉语言模型需求 在现代物流系统中,包裹信息的自动识别是提升分拣效率、降低人工成本的关键环节。传统OCR技术在面对模糊、倾斜、低光照或复杂背景下的快递单据时&#xf…

作者头像 李华
网站建设 2026/4/18 5:37:38

基于FunASR语音识别WebUI快速部署实践|科哥二次开发镜像详解

基于FunASR语音识别WebUI快速部署实践|科哥二次开发镜像详解 1. 背景与目标 随着语音交互技术的普及,中文语音识别在智能客服、会议记录、教育辅助等场景中展现出巨大潜力。然而,从零搭建一个稳定可用的语音识别系统对开发者而言仍存在较高…

作者头像 李华
网站建设 2026/4/17 9:50:38

OpenCore Simplify:3步解锁专业级黑苹果配置新体验

OpenCore Simplify:3步解锁专业级黑苹果配置新体验 【免费下载链接】OpCore-Simplify A tool designed to simplify the creation of OpenCore EFI 项目地址: https://gitcode.com/GitHub_Trending/op/OpCore-Simplify 还在为复杂的EFI配置而烦恼&#xff1f…

作者头像 李华